Oh, Boston is such a vibrant city with so much to offer, especially for baseball fans like yourself! For your 2-day trip to catch a Boston Red Sox game, here's an ideal itinerary:
Morning: Start your day with a delicious breakfast at a local cafe or diner near Fenway Park to fuel up for the day ahead. Late Morning: Head over to Fenway Park, the iconic home of the Boston Red Sox. Take a guided tour of the stadium to learn about its rich history and get a behind-the-scenes look at the ballpark. Lunch: Grab a bite to eat at one of the many restaurants or food stands inside Fenway Park for a true ballpark experience. Afternoon: Explore the surrounding neighborhood of Fenway, known for its vibrant atmosphere and great shopping. Check out Yawkey Way for some unique souvenirs. Evening: Enjoy dinner at a local restaurant near Fenway Park before heading back to the stadium to watch the Red Sox game. Immerse yourself in the electric atmosphere of a live baseball game and cheer on the home team!
Morning: Start your day with a leisurely breakfast at a cozy cafe in the city before embarking on a sightseeing tour of Boston. Visit iconic landmarks like the Freedom Trail, Faneuil Hall, and the Boston Common. Lunch: Stop for lunch at a seafood restaurant to try some delicious New England clam chowder or lobster roll. Afternoon: Explore the historic neighborhoods of Boston, such as Beacon Hill or the North End, known for their charming streets and rich history. Don't forget to stop by the Paul Revere House or the USS Constitution Museum. Evening: Enjoy a relaxing dinner at a waterfront restaurant with stunning views of the Boston Harbor. Take a leisurely stroll along the Harborwalk to soak in the beautiful city skyline before heading back to your hotel.
